Trees Are Attacking Worldwide!


The opening in the tree looked like a mouth that had surrounded its "prey" and was about to swallow it whole! It appears to be a tray of approximately 20 inches (50 centimeters) in diameter and about 3/4 of it has already disappeared into the tree!


The tray has the logo of the Feldscholssen beer company written "Birra" in Italian. I wrote an article about their fabulous factory which I visited in July of 2017


I saw this anomaly last week as I was coming home from work. It would seem that someone placed the tray in an opening in the tree many years ago and that soon the poor tray will be "gone". This phenomena is more common than one might first think. Many have seen photographs that circulate around the internet of a bicycle that appears to have been devoured by a tree!

Here is a Famous Metal Eating Tree!


Photo Credit: This is the famous "Bicycle Eaten by A Tree"  which is found on Vashon Island in Washington State. The "real story of how it got there can be found here!

Is Eating Metal Harmful to Trees?


According to my limited research on the subject Metal placed into a tree should not harm it if it is healthy. The metal object will not get higher in the tree as it grows but because the tree grows a new layer of wood just under the bark every year eventually it will "swallow" whatever object is placed in it!

This amazing forest is located in Poland near the town of Gryfino. It is called "Crooked Forest" or "Drunken Forest". 400 pines that grow curved just towards the north were planted in the 1930s. Nobody knows until now why they are so growing. Some say that there were strong winds and they twisted the trees, someone says that they planted specially for furniture. The most interesting of the versions is that the breeder decided to plant a forest where people could not get lost, so everyone is bent to the north, but the second world war prevented him from fulfilling the idea.
